ORTELIUS, Abraham (1527-98). Americae sive nobi orbis, nova descriptio, [Antwerp:] 1587. Engraved map, elaborate baroque title cartouche, galleons and sea-monster, French text on verso (2 holes, one very small in sea area, the other 4 x 3mm. affecting edge of cartouche, very lightly browned, marginal tear), 355 x 483mm. Burden The Mapping of North America 64; Schwartz & Ehrenberg p.69; Tooley The Mapping of America vol. II, p.321.

"One of the most famous and easily recognised maps of America, and one that is both functional as as well as decorative ... had a great influence on the future cartography of the New World" (Burden, referring to the 1570 issue).
